Bryan Mbeumo open to joining Manchester United, talks with Brentford to intensify in the coming weeks – Man United News And Transfer News

Having seen Rasmus Hojlund stumble in front of goal all season, Manchester United head coach Ruben Amorim is naturally on the lookout for a goalscoring option who is versatile and Premier League proven.

Which explains why the club are close to signing Matheus Cunha of Wolverhampton Wanderers, who has impressed the Portuguese tactician with his ability in front of goal and his eye for a killer pass.

However, the Brazilian is not the only player on the club’s radar with The Peoples Person relaying that Bryan Mbeumo of Brentford is another option that the club have as backup.

And as per Fichajes, talks are expected to intensify in the coming weeks with the Cameroonian “revelation” open to leaving the Bees in the summer.

Mbeumo talks to start

In fact, as the report suggests, the 25-year-old would find a move to Old Trafford hard to turn down. He has 18 goals and seven assists in all competitions this season.

“Manchester United have their sights set on one of the brightest revelations of the current season in England. Bryan Mbeumo, Brentford’s Cameroonian striker.

“Mbeumo, for his part, is reportedly open to a career leap, and the option to wear the Manchester United shirt is a challenge that’s hard to turn down.

“Talks could intensify in the coming weeks, and Brentford already recognizes that retaining him will be a difficult task given the interest from a club as historically important and ambitious as Old Trafford.”

Fits Amorim’s style

Reports have suggested that the Bees are likely to demand around £50 million to let him go given his importance to Thomas Frank’s plans.

But his current contract with the London club is valid until 2026 and the chances of a cut-price exit cannot be ignored especially if Brentford fail to agree a new contract and if the player himself pushes for a move.

Mbeumo can play up front, as an attacking midfielder and even out wide, with versatility seen as a key attribute by Amorim. The Cameroon international figures in the 97th percentile for chances created and 100 percentile for successful crosses.

Defensively, he’s no slouch either. He is in the 92nd percentile for duels won and in the 98th percentile for possession won back in the final third (all stats via fotmob). These stats show how much of a perfect fit he would be for Amorim.
